Esther Mary Ross, 108, passed away Thursday, May 29, 2025, at Bethany Home in Sioux Falls.

Esther was born on May 1, 1917, to Fred and Magdalena (Kowalke) Hein in Cumberland, Wisconsin. She grew up on a farm near Wolsey, South Dakota. She worked at Bagley Hardware Store in Wessington, South Dakota.

Esther married Gerald Ross on May 2, 1939, in Sioux Falls, South Dakota. She was a member at First Lutheran Church in Volga and helped in several church offices. She was a past member of the Joy Club, the neighborhood birthday club, a 34-year member of the Volga Homemakers Extension Club, and the knit and stitch sewing club. She is a member of Faith Lutheran Church in Sioux Falls, SD.

Esther enjoyed sewing, working on crossword puzzles, making quilts, and crocheting. She loved to watch her grandchildren and great-grandchildren grow and hear about all their activities.
